Unlock instant, AI-driven research and patent intelligence for your innovation.

Explosive data cache processing system and method for scada system

A technology of data caching and processing methods, applied in the field of data processing, which can solve problems such as SCADA system crashes, database crashes, and high database loads, and achieve the effects of ensuring security and improving responsiveness

Inactive Publication Date: 2017-09-15
BEIJING KEDONG ELECTRIC POWER CONTROL SYST
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] First, because the explosive data storage request will gather massive data in a short period of time, waiting to submit the database in the memory may cause memory overflow, resulting in the loss of a large amount of important data
What's more, it will cause the entire SCADA system to collapse directly, and the consequences will be disastrous
[0006] Second, too many data storage requests will reduce the responsiveness of the SCADA system and affect the operation of other application processes
[0007] Third, a large number of database connections will cause the database load to be too high, and even cause the database to crash, directly affecting other processes' access to the database

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Explosive data cache processing system and method for scada system
  • Explosive data cache processing system and method for scada system
  • Explosive data cache processing system and method for scada system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0045] The present invention will be further described in detail below in conjunction with the drawings and specific embodiments.

[0046] Such as figure 1 As shown, the present invention provides a SCADA system-oriented explosive data buffer processing system, including: a data receiving module, a file buffer module, a data pre-reading module, a queue buffer module, a data optimization module, and a thread pool module. Among them, the data receiving module is connected to the queue buffer module and the file buffer module, the file buffer module is connected to the queue buffer module through the data pre-reading module, the queue buffer module is connected to the data optimization module, and the data optimization module is connected to the thread pool module.

[0047] The data receiving module receives the data storage request sent by the application, and puts the data storage request into the disk cache file or the cache queue of the file cache module according to the state of t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a SCADA system-oriented burst data cache processing system and a method thereof. The system includes: a data receiving module, a file cache module, a data pre-reading module, a queue cache module, a data optimization module, and a thread pool module; among them, the data receiving module receives the data storage request message sent by the application program, and according to the state of the cache queue Put it into the disk cache file or cache queue of the file cache module; the data pre-reading module inserts the data storage request stored in the file cache module into the cache queue; the data optimization module reads the data storage request in the cache queue, and the data storage After the request is optimized, the idle thread in the thread pool is called to perform data storage operations. The invention can better solve the security problems of the requested data and the SCADA system when submitting a mass data storage request.

Description

Technical field [0001] The invention relates to a data cache processing system, in particular to a SCADA system-oriented explosive data cache processing system, and also relates to a method for the system to realize explosive data cache processing, and belongs to the technical field of data processing. Background technique [0002] SCADA (Data Acquisition and Monitoring Control) system is a computer-based production process control and dispatch automation system, which is widely used in electric power, metallurgy, petroleum, chemical and other industries. As the scale of SCADA systems continues to increase, more and more content and data need to be monitored. SCADA systems are constantly facing the test of massive data processing. [0003] In recent years, with the rapid development of computer and network technologies, a large number of computer and network technologies have been applied to SCADA systems, making the application functions of SCADA systems more and more powerful. H...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F17/30
Inventor 叶飞马志斌厉启鹏王恒李晓蕾宋光鹏温昭奇陈清山孙頔
Owner BEIJING KEDONG ELECTRIC POWER CONTROL SYST